This one may sound crazy, but a source close to WWE Creative told WrestleVotes Radio that the winner of the King of the Ring tournament was not “firmly decided” when the bracket was revealed. The source says at least three different stars were internally pitched as the tournament winner, and these wrestlers were strategically placed in the bracket with that option in mind.
While this may seem like a sign of turmoil in WWE Creative, the more optimistic guess is that WWE did this as a reaction to so many recent plans being changed due to injury. Rather than put all their eggs in one basket for the King of the Ring winner, perhaps WWE wants to maintain some storytelling flexibility just in case another emergency strikes.
WrestleVotes speculates it’s also possible that WWE and Brock Lesnar have yet to agree on when his trilogy with Oba Femi will finish, which would complicate Oba’s booking in this tournament until that issue is resolved.
Votes wasn’t told the names of the specific stars who were pitched as King of the Ring winners, but it’s hard to imagine that group doesn’t include Femi, Seth Rollins, and Bron Breakker at the very least, and maybe even LA Knight or Jey Uso.
